Output f3f68352884de14ccf5f8095d75baad5cbf686f6af2a96d433e4e584fc0ba847:5

value
31776507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4ca356acc62e03f9d14b85057a28b0502dfdd61 OP_EQUAL
address
MNvVHbRxLCh7mvNpyvAiRYeLCtkR529rmv
transaction
f3f68352884de14ccf5f8095d75baad5cbf686f6af2a96d433e4e584fc0ba847
spent
true